Researching the Market

When Researching the Market for selling your car privately in Iowa, it’s essential to gather relevant data to set a competitive price. Here’s how to navigate this step effectively:

  • Check Online Platforms: Review similar car listings on websites like Craigslist and Facebook Marketplace to gauge prices.
  • Consult Pricing Guides: Refer to resources like Kelley Blue Book and NADA Guides for valuable insights on your car’s worth.
  • Compare Condition: Take into account your vehicle’s age, mileage, condition, and unique features when determining pricing.
  • Consider Market Trends: Be aware of seasonal fluctuations and local demand that might impact your selling price.
  • Stay Flexible: Remain open to adjusting your price based on feedback and interest from potential buyers.

Embrace the research process as a decisive factor in setting the right price for your vehicle in the competitive Iowa market.

Preparing Your Car for Sale

When Preparing Your Car for Sale, it’s essential to make a great first impression. Here are some key steps to get your vehicle in top shape:

  • Clean Inside and Out: A clean car shows that you’ve taken good care of it. Consider a professional detailing service for a deep clean.
  • Address Mechanical Issues: Fix any mechanical issues to ensure your car runs smoothly. Regular maintenance can increase its value.
  • Gather Maintenance Records: Maintenance records provide transparency and build trust with potential buyers. Keep them organized and readily available.
  • Take High-Quality Photos: Photos are the first thing buyers see online. Make sure to capture clear and bright images that highlight your car’s best features.
  • Consider Minor Repairs: Addressing minor repairs like a cracked windshield or dents can go a long way in improving your car’s appeal.
  • Spruce Up the Interior: Clean the interior thoroughly, consider air fresheners, and make sure everything is in working order.

Setting the Right Price

When setting the price for your car, research is key. Look at similar vehicles in your area to get an idea of the market value. Remember that factors like mileage, condition, and features can all influence the price point.

Consider pricing competitively. While you want to get a good price, setting it too high can deter potential buyers. Conversely, pricing too low may raise suspicions about the car’s condition.

Don’t forget to factor in negotiation room. Buyers often expect to haggle, so leaving a little wiggle room in your price can help seal the deal satisfactorily for both parties.

Furthermore, if your car has unique features or recent upgrades, highlight these when justifying your price to potential buyers. Transparency about your reasons for the price can build trust and aid in the selling process.

Keep in mind that a well-priced car often sells faster, so take the time to do your research and set a competitive, yet fair price.

Advertising Your Car

When it comes to Advertising Your Car for sale in Iowa, online platforms are your best friend. Consider using popular websites like Craigslist, Facebook Marketplace, and Autotrader to reach a wide audience.

Capture high-quality photos of your car from various angles in good lighting. Be transparent with the car’s condition to avoid wasting your time and potential buyers’ time.

Write a compelling description highlighting key features, recent maintenance, and upgrades. Use keywords like “low mileage” or “one owner” to attract more interest.

Transferring Ownership Successfully

When selling your car in Iowa, transferring ownership correctly is crucial. After negotiating a deal with the buyer, you’ll need to complete the necessary paperwork to finalize the sale. Here are the essential steps to ensure a smooth transfer of ownership:

  • Bill of Sale: Prepare a bill of sale that includes the vehicle’s details, sale price, date of sale, and both parties’ information.
  • Vehicle Title: Sign over the vehicle title to the buyer and ensure it’s filled out accurately.
  • Odometer Disclosure Statement: Fill out the odometer disclosure statement to provide an accurate mileage reading to the new owner.
  • Release of Liability: Submit the release of liability form to the Iowa Department of Transportation to protect yourself from any future issues related to the vehicle.
  • Registration Certificate: Provide the buyer with a copy of the registration certificate to transfer ownership with the Iowa DOT.

By following these steps, you can transfer ownership of your car securely and protect yourself from any potential liabilities. Stay organized and keep copies of all documents for your records.
